Use a rating of 5 if your space has no insulation, 1.5 if it has weak insulation, 1 if it has average insulation, and 0.5 if it has strong insulation. The degree of insulation should be rated based on how far above or below it is from the recommended average. Check the recommended R-value of your region by clicking here. Walls in rooms in extremely cold climates require an R-value of 25-30, while walls in rooms in extremely warm climates only require an R-value of 13-15. The recommended degree of insulation, what’s considered average for a home, varies considerably from region to region. Next, estimate the degree of insulation in your garage.
